Regulation (EU) 2018/1240, adopted by the European Parliament and the Council on 12 September 2018, establishes the European Travel Information and Authorisation System (ETIAS) - an electronic travel authorisation system for visitors entering the Schengen Area or Cyprus for a short stay (up to 90 days within any 180-day period). The system applies to nationals of visa-exempt third countries, who will be required to obtain travel authorisation prior to their journey.

ETIAS is intended to strengthen border management by enhancing security, preventing illegal immigration, protecting public health, and supporting the objectives of the Schengen Information System. It also aims to facilitate more efficient border checks and assist in the prevention, detection, and investigation of terrorism and other serious crimes.

The system is expected to launch in late 2026. While no immediate action is required, stakeholders are encouraged to stay informed and prepare for the changes.
